Detailed Description
This function is used to detect torque levels in order to check for overtorque or undertorque. When enabled, the following selection can be assigned to
the multi-function output terminals (H2-01, H2-02, and H2-03).

Note: The torque detection function uses a hysteresis of about 10% of the drive rated output current. The torque detection level in V/f Control is 100% of the drive rated output
current. In Open Loop Vector, it is defined as 100% of the motor rated torque.
NOTICE: When overtorque occurs, the drive may stop due to overcurrent or overload (OL1). To prevent this, the drive should quickly detect overtorque situations. Problems with
undertorque can result in a torn belt, a pump shutting off, or other similar trouble.

0: Disabled
1: OL3 at Speed Agree - Alarm (Overtorque Detection only active during Speed Agree and
Operation continues after detection).
2: OL3 at RUN - Alarm (Overtorque Detection is always active and operation continues after
detection).
3: OL3 at Speed Agree - Fault (Overtorque Detection only active during Speed Agree and drive
output will shut down on an OL3 fault).
4: OL3 at RUN - Fault (Overtorque Detection is always active and drive output will shut down
on an OL3 fault).
5: UL3 at Speed Agree - Alarm (Undertorque Detection is only active during Speed Agree and
operation continues after detection).
6: UL3 at RUN - Alarm (Undertorque Detection is always active and operation continues after
detection).
7: UL3 at Speed Agree - Fault (Undertorque Detection only active during Speed Agree and
drive output will shut down on an OL3 fault).
8: UL3 at RUN - Fault (Undertorque Detection is always active and drive output will shut down
on an OL3 fault).
